PwC eager to maintain lead in division 3 ahead of finals

Sports

By JAMIE HARO
PWC are aiming to maintain their top four spot in the Private Corporate Netball Competition’s division three leading into the finals.
The Glenda Ray-captained side defeated NCDC1 12-9 in a close encounter to conclude round two over the weekend.
Ray said the team’s loses in round one inspired them to improve their performance and commitment in round two.
“We have come a long way in round one games,” Ray said.
“We lost four matches so in round two, we made a goal to win all our matches.
“Unfortunately last Sunday we drew with City Pharmacy Limited, however for us to win in round two was more of a comeback for us.
“As both professionals and support staff of PwC, we are happy with our level of commitment we put in to get a good result.”
Ray said the team identified errors in round one and made improvements.
“Slowing the game down was our key focus to displace our opponents in order for us to be in charge and control of the game, that’s how we as a team made a difference,” she said.
“We are fourth on the ladder for division three and our goal is to ensure we make it into the knockouts and the finals.”
